In immersion lithography, a single exposure resolution of 36.5 nm half pitch (k = 0.255) has been demonstrated with a numerical aperture of 1.35. However the practical resolution limit in production will be closer to 40 nm half pitch (k = 0.28), without involving double patterning alike strategies, such as self-aligned double patterning (SADP).
